Tanya was measuring the ability of different substances to dissolve in water. She mixed in each test tube the same amount of water and substance. She then measured the level of undissolved solute at the bottom of the test tube once it settled. Her results are in the chart.
A 2-column table with 4 rows. The first row titled substance has entries W, X, Y, and Z. The second column titled level of undissolved solute has entries 0.5 millimeters, 1.0 centimeters, 0.5 centimeters, 0.1 millimeters.
Which best describes the solutions?
Substance W has the greatest solubility.
Substance X has the greatest solubility.
Substance Y has the greatest solubility.
Substance Z has the greatest solubility.

Substance Z has the greatest solubility.
Explanation: with the same amount added, Z left the least undissolved (0.1 mm), so the most of it dissolved (compare: W 0.5 mm, Y 5 mm, X 10 mm).
